Positioning Principles

No matter your monitors, you’ll want to follow two key rules:

  1. Create an equilateral triangle between you and the speakers, spaced evenly apart.
  2. Position tweeters at ear height when seated at the mix position.

This will optimize the listening experience. Now let’s get into setup!

Connecting Your Monitors

To hook up studio monitors to your audio interface, you’ll need speaker cables – either XLR or 1/4″ TRS cables. Balanced TRS cables are recommended over TS instrument cables for minimal noise and interference.

Set Up Your Cables

Run one cable from your audio interface’s left output to your left monitor’s input. Connect the right accordingly. Make sure to get channel assignment correct! If monitors are reversed, stereo imaging will be flipped.

Speaker Placement

Now it’s time to position those monitors properly. This is key for accurate stereo imaging and frequency reproduction.

The Equilateral Triangle

As mentioned before, your mix position and monitors should form an equilateral triangle – equal distances between all three points. Angling the speakers inward ensures the sound reaches your ears directly.

Pro tip: Use a tape measure! The distance from each speaker to your ears should be identical to the distance between the two speakers. Get specific.

Position Tweeters at Ear Height

Studies show aligning the tweeter with your ear height provides the optimal listening experience. This prevents excessive high frequency attenuation from misalignment.

Sit in your mix position and measure the distance from the floor to your ears. Set your speakers on stands or blocks to match this height. Voila!

Give ‘Em Some Space

In a perfect world, your monitors would be placed away from walls and corners to avoid unwanted low frequency buildup and early reflections.

But for small home studios, try to allow at least 8-12 inches between your monitors and adjacent walls. Every inch counts in preventing muddiness!

Measuring and Analyzing Your Room

Now we need to determine how your unique room affects the sound at your mix position. This will tell us exactly how to treat it and tune the monitors. Time to break out the measurement mic!

Measurement Microphones

A measurement mic along with analyzing software like Room EQ Wizard or Sonarworks will help you identify any dips or peaks caused by room acoustics.

Place the measurement mic where your head goes when mixing. Take readings of pink noise through your monitors to detect resonances.

Analyze and Identify Problems

Look for spikes or dips in certain frequencies that deviate from the ideal flat response. Try shifting speaker placement to reduce these. Standing waves and flutter echoes are common problems.

Make note of any persistent issues across the frequency spectrum. This will inform your acoustic treatment plan.

Treating Your Room

No room is perfect right out of the box. Judicious placement of acoustic treatment can work wonders at ironing out issues.

Absorption vs Diffusion

Absorptive treatment like foam soaks up reflections to reduce anomalies. Diffusion scatters sound evenly to maintain space, using shapes like pyramids.

You’ll want a balance of both absorption and diffusion. Too much deadening can suck life out of the sound. Find the right blend for your space.

Place Panels Strategically

Focus on early reflection points between monitors and mix position first. Ceiling and floors are often overlooked but important too!

Corner bass traps address low end buildup. Get creative – hanging panels and other solutions can help when wall space is limited.

Speaker Calibration

Calibration ensures your monitors reproduce sound at a known loudness. This provides a consistent reference for mixing.

Use Pink Noise and a SPL Meter

You’ll need a sound pressure level (SPL) meter and a pink noise audio source to calibrate. Many smartphones have SPL meter apps!

With pink noise playing through both speakers, adjust level until SPL meter at mix position reads ~83 dB SPL C-weighted.

Consider Your Genre

For film or orchestral mixing, calibrate closer to 79-82 dB SPL to better align with theater levels. Louder genres like rock can go a bit higher.

Mark your volume knob for reference. Recheck calibration periodically as speaker components age over time.

Mixing on Headphones

While monitors are ideal, headphone mixing may be necessary at times. Here are some tips!

Headphone Mixing Drawbacks

Headphones can cause ear fatigue faster. A key challenge is the lack of crosstalk and room ambience.

Adding subtle crossfeed reverb or using plugins like Redline Monitor can help mimic speaker imaging and space.

Follow Best Practices

Keep headphone volume lower to avoid fatigue. Take regular breaks to rest your ears – they work hard when monitoring!

Do final checks on speakers if possible. Even pros use both headphones and monitors to cover all bases.

Reference Mixing

Referencing commercial tracks in your genre helps tune your ears during mixing.

Compare With Well-Known Mixes

Use your set calibration levels! Compare your mix against trusted references at matched loudness.

Listen for differences in EQ, panning, and spatial imaging. Take notes on what to adjust in your mix.

Bounce Between References

Try A/B comparisons between multiple references to understand the range of tones and balances employed. Expand your perspective!
